Maybe they just start what is autoimmunity? Maybe explain to people in simple terms what exactly it is. Yeah, autoimmunity is basically when you have an immune disorder where your immune system actually will attack its own bodily tissues, right.
And so if you have autoimmunity to your thyroid gland, right, that's, you know, could either your thought you might either put out too much thyroid hormone or too little. We call it Hashimoto's thyroiditis. That's an autoimmune hypothyroidism. And then autoimmune hypothyroidism is graves disease. If you have autoimmunity to connective tissue and joints, depending on the the features of that, it could be rheumatoid arthritis right. Or lupus or something along those lines. So there's all these different autoimmune conditions I believe there's over 100 autoimmune conditions.
You could basically develop autoimmunity to any major protein in your body. And this is a sign that your immune system, in a sense, the way I think about it is it's kind of like if there was an alarm that went off in your city and all the police came out with their guns, but they were blindfolded. And so there's an alarm. They know there's bad guys out there, but they just start shooting because they can't see anything. And that's basically what's happening in your body. Your immune system is doing everything it can to protect you from a systemic infection.
In fact, we know that infections actually killed more of our ancestors than anything else. The reason why was our ancestors, if they got a flesh wound or they didn't know how to sterilize it. Right. And so what happened was, you know, they got a flesh wound. A lot of times bacteria will get in into the bloodstream and it would spread into their lungs, cause, cause pneumonia or into their nervous system and cause meningitis or encephalitis or something like that. And that's why people would die. And so because of that, the immune system understands that high infectious load and a high infectious load in the bloodstream is life threatening.
So it has to do everything it can to make sure that that doesn't happen. Because our body, of course, it's built for survival. And so we'll live with chronic low grade inflammation for a long time or autoimmunity like you can live 20, 30, 40, 50 years with autoimmunity. You just don't live well. And so our body will sacrifice living well to live. Right. It's a good payoff, right? From that perspective, what we gotta do is figure out what is causing all this high pathogenic load. Right. And toxins from seeping into the bloodstream, driving up this sort of autoimmune or chronic inflammatory response.
That's what we have to do and shut off that valve. Right. So that way we can lower the overall what we call allostatic load the overall pathogenic load or disease causing load in our system and return our body back to homeostasis and overall balance. Yeah. Well for sure. Well, you know, we've we've all been taught especially, you know, in medical school, most people have been taught at some point that are listening, have been taught that the mitochondria are what produced the energy within the cells. So for us to produce cellular energy, ATP, the mitochondria will take carbohydrates, I'll take glucose, I'll take fatty acids, and that will produce cellular energy.
And so basically this is what we're taught. But really the mitochondria are much more complex in that they're kind of like the nervous system of the cell.
Cell danger response and mitochondrial dysfunction 13:12
So they are constantly adapting their energy production and the amount of oxidative stress that's produced within them based around what's happening in the environment. And so when they sense that there's a peacetime environment, right, when all of our potential overloads of stress, right, pathogens, toxins, our mental, emotional stressors, physical stressors, all those things are under control. They're going to produce a lot of energy and just a small amount of oxidative stress. However, when our load of pathogens infectious load goes up, the amount of toxins that we're being exposed to goes up.
We're we're dealing with a lot of mental, emotional stressors, PTSD, lots of different factors like that, or could be physical stress, like a concussion or something along those lines. When those things happen and they build up and go beyond a certain threshold. Now the mitochondria say, okay, we're in a war time physiology. They actually lower energy production and they increase the amount of oxidative stress. And oxidative stress is like internal rusting, and it's the precursor to inflammation.
Inflammation comes out to help clean up the oxidative stress. And so they're actually turning up inflammation throughout the body. Now every single person that's listening to this has experienced this cell danger response very quickly. At some point in their life, for example, we've all gotten the flu. And what happens, right? I actually got this in a few months ago, I felt great. It was a Tuesday night. I felt great, felt awesome. Went to bed, woke up somewhere in the middle of the night. I was like, oh, that's weird.
I woke up, you know, and I just couldn't. I had trouble falling back asleep. And I got up the next day and I just didn't feel my best. And as the day went on, my energy was going down further and further and further. So I went from a ten out of ten energy level to maybe like a two out of ten, where I was just completely sapped. Right. And it was like that for like 2 or 3 days. And that was my body saying, okay, my viral load was so high, right, that we need to shut down energy production. We're in a wartime physiology right now, and this is part of the internal detoxification system that my body need to undergo.
We turned up oxidative stress, turned up inflammation. My body needed to rest, right? I needed to rest, relax, do things to help support recovery. And then, you know, I would say a week later I was ten out of ten with my energy levels. Right. Within three days, you know, I went from maybe a two out of ten to a five out of ten, six out of ten. Every day I would go up a little bit more. You know, after a week, I was a ten out of ten. I was completely out of that. So danger response. I completed the healing cycle.
Problem is that for many people, they get hit, whether it's a flu or maybe they eat something, you know, with a high bacterial load on it and they get salmonella or, you know, they get bit by a tick, and now they get exposed to Borrelia or some sort of, you know, co-infection. Their body oftentimes undergoes this kind of initial acute response. Right? And they start to almost complete the healing cycle, but they never really do. And then they never they kind of plateau in their healing process. And they never get better.
Right. And over time, actually, they get oftentimes get worse with each passing month that goes by when they're not completing that healing cycle. And this is what many people do when their mitochondria are stuck in this cell. Danger response, not producing optimal cellular energy and producing lots of oxidative stress, triggering inflammation and triggering changes in the entire function and structure of the immune system to where now they're they're putting out lots and lots of antibodies to different proteins that are in the body and ultimately down the road after many years, oftentimes many years of this will be diagnosed with autoimmune condition.

Let's talk a little bit about it. Yeah for sure. Well you know obviously we can get infections from a bite from a tick bite a spider bite from a from some sort of a wound.
Infections, leaky gut, and the microbiome 19:30
Right. And we've all kind of, you know, that's why we if you get a wound right, what do you typically do. Put hydrogen peroxide on it or something like that to make sure that we don't have a high amount of infectious bacteria getting into our bloodstream, propagating and spreading out tons and tons of toxins that drive up inflammation in the body and cause major issues. And so we understand that it can come from the external. But, you know, I would say we're infections typically are causing obviously with Lyme it's it's oftentimes a bite.
But we have to look at the intestines as well. So in our gut our intestinal lining is basically like the gut is like a long tube that's separating our bloodstream from the outside environment. And so everything that's going through there is there's a protective barrier trying to protect what actually gets into the bloodstream and what stays in the gut and moves out through our feces. And so the intestinal lining, particularly in the small intestine, is only one cell wall thick. And that's because our ancestors had food scarcity at times.
And so they had a lot of times where there wasn't a whole lot of food available. So when they got when they had access to food, they needed easy nutrient delivery. And so only passing through one cell wall allows for easy nutrient delivery. In our society today we have an abundance of food. So we all have pantries full of food. It's pretty easy to access food in a in a first world country, and so we don't deal with that anymore. In fact, what we're dealing with now is high amounts of infections and toxins coming in from our food supply, causing inflammation in the gut, degrading the mucosa mucosal barrier.
And so along the one cell in our intestines we have mucus mucous membrane. And that's really where the the immune component of our gut lies is called Secretary IGA. And in order to have a healthy gut we need a really healthy mucus lining. And so the food that we're consuming, oftentimes we are causing inflammation in that and degrading that mucous membrane and damaging the actual gut lining, allowing for large proteins as well as bacteria and different pathogens and the toxins they produce, the endotoxins to actually get into the bloodstream, driving up inflammation throughout our body.
And so those infectious microbes, when kept under control, are fine. But when they get into the bloodstream, they start propagating and releasing their toxins. It's showing up really kind of all over the place. Explained a little bit about how this relates to autoimmunity and and why people need to be so careful with their simple carbohydrates, for sure. Well, blood sugar, sugar in general are basically any sort of carbohydrate other than fiber. So starch and sugar, our body turns that into glucose.
And we can measure that on your blood glucose levels. And you have to you're always going to have some level of blood glucose, because there are cells in your body that can only run on glucose, right? In fact, the brain cells need a certain supply of of glucose. They can also run off of something called ketones. And we can come back to that. But we always have to have some level of blood glucose. But we need it in this tight range. And when blood glucose goes too high, like for example, somebody that has somebody that's diabetic, right?
What happens is the glucose molecules will actually bind to proteins in the body and create a sticky protein. We also call these advanced glycation end products Agee's. These eggs are like shrapnel going through the bloodstream. These sticky proteins drive up inflammation in the body, particularly in the endothelial lining of the blood vessels, and they damage the blood vessels. And so when you think about somebody that has uncontrolled diabetes, where their blood sugar has been really high for a long period of time, what happens?
They develop peripheral neuropathy where they've damaged their nerves and they can't even feel their feet. Sometimes optic neuritis, they lose their vision. They typically they're dying from heart disease. Right. Because the blood vessels have been so damaged or kidney disease. Right. Where, you know, oftentimes, you know, they're kidneys shut down. They need dialysis, right? They have fatty liver disease. And so basically it's damaging all these major organ systems. And so insulin is this superhero hormone.
Insulin resistance, diet, and blood sugar control 28:30
Its job is to take sugar out of the bloodstream and put it into the cells. Were can now be used to produce energy. It also pulls out other other key compounds like like magnesium. It helps shuttle magnesium into the cells for for energy production and and for utilization. And so we really need good we need insulin production. But we need our cells to be very responsive to insulin. And so what happens every time we eat we're producing some level of insulin. And the more there are certain foods that are more in slow genic meaning when we eat certain foods, particularly ultra processed foods, your candy chips, you know, all the middle sections of the grocery store, those are the are highly in slow genic.
So when we eat those, we produce high amounts of insulin. When we eat real foods, right. If we eat, you know, a, you know, a, let's say a cucumber, right? Or, a big salad or a steak or, even just, you know, potatoes or something like that. We're not going to produce a ton of insulin because these are whole real foods. They've got natural fibers, natural protein, things like that. They're less insulin genic okay. So we are going to produce insulin. We're going to produce a whole lot whole lot of it.
And so that's why a real food diet is so critical here when we're eating ultra processed foods, things with added sugar, added starch in them, we're producing high amounts of insulin. When we produce high amounts of insulin, our cells stop responding well to the insulin. We stop getting a lot of sugar getting into the cells. And that's because the more sugar we're driving into the cells, more oxidative stress goes up in those cells, the more internal rusting process takes place. Also, when insulin gets elevated beyond a certain threshold in the blood, it stops natural cellular healing processes.
It drives up cell reproduction without so without good cellular healing. When insulin goes down, like for example, every night we should be fasting overnight. We should, you know, we stop eating at a certain time and we shouldn't eat, you know, until, you know, later, you know, let's say, you know, mid-morning or later in the day and insulin will go down beyond a certain threshold. And when it does that, the body actually triggers natural self-healing processes. We call this autophagy, where the cells will actually break down old damaged mitochondria or damaged proteins and actually recycle them, take the raw materials and produce new, healthy, more stress resilient mitochondria, new, healthy, more stress resilient cellular organelles, and that allows a cell to function better.
This is normal. This is what should happen. But when insulin is elevated in our blood, like most people in our society are walking around with, we don't burn fat for fuel and we don't undergo autophagy effectively to repair the cellular organelles. And so now we're not in a state where we're not healing, right. We're not internally healing, and we actually start storing fat. As long as insulin is elevated, we can't burn fat for fuel. We get stuck in this kind of chronic sugar burning mode, and we're producing high amounts of oxidative stress, damaging all the cellular mechanics.
And, you know, again, we can't burn fat for fuel. Fat is where we store toxins. It's an energy storage that we all have, right. But we want to be great fat burners. We want to be burning through fat as our primary energy source for most of the day, particularly while we're sleeping at night. And that's super critical for a healthy metabolism. It's also critical for detoxification and for keeping inflammation under control. The more these fat cells start to grow, or the more we're feeding the fat cells, and particular we start developing visceral fat, which is this type of fat that surrounds the organ systems.
And we used to think fat was just a storage form of energy. And that is an important component of fat. But fat is also an endocrine organ, meaning that it will actually release cytotoxic cytokines. Right. And it's in a sense part of the immune system. It's actually releasing compounds that, that drive up inflammation in the body and also reduces oxygen delivery to major systems of the body, like when we develop fatty liver that's not just fat on the liver, it's actually liver cells that are becoming damaged because they can't produce they're undergoing high amounts of oxidative stress.
And so we're actually getting damaged liver cells. And so now the liver is not able to do what it needs to do filtering, detoxifying the blood, creating key proteins, all the different things that it needs to do. And we've got excess fat building up around it, which is going to create a bit of a, vicious cycle right where it's going to further reduce oxygen and nutrient delivery to the liver cells. So this is a significant issue. We need a tight zone for blood sugar. So we want to be eating foods. Right.
And I always recommend eating 2 to 3 meals a day. High protein right. Lots of colorful fruits and vegetables some healthy fats. That's what you want to do. That's going to create blood sugar stability. Do everything you can to reduce the ultra processed foods. Right. And really stick with whole foods. Yeah, absolutely. A high polyphenol extra virgin olive oil. One of the best things you could possibly put in your body. So powerful for reducing inflammation in your body with your meat. You know, I always say there's a couple changes with your nutrition. Number one is you want to reduce your consumption of, you know, processed foods like I talked about and seed oils. Right. That's number two. So anything with corn, soybeans, safflower, cotton seed, peanut oil, all of those types of canola oil, all those types of processed seed oils.
You want to avoid the fruit oils like avocado right. Or avocado oil and extra virgin olive oil or olives in general. Very good, very healthy. They're lower in inflammatory omega six fats, high in anti-inflammatory mono unsaturated fats, also high in polyphenol antioxidants. And so, they're, olive oil, for example, is high oxidative stability. It's really, really good in the body. Lots of lots of antioxidants. So that's really, really good. And then with the meat you want to make sure you get going organic, grass fed, pasture raised, wild caught because you want to do everything you can to reduce chemicals and toxins.
And so when we're eating, you know, your typical grain fed, conventionally raised animal products, they're feeding them grains, which skews their fatty acid ratio. And then on top of that, those grains are covered with glyphosate and other chemicals. And so they're bio accumulating that inside of their body. So their dairy products, their eggs, their, you know, their meat is going to be full of that stuff. And so to, to reduce your chemical load, you want to go as organic as possible, especially with meat products.
Now when it comes to produce, ideally you're going organic. But there is the clean 15 and dirty dozen. So the general rule is if a, you know, if you're going to eat the outer layer of something, you really should go organic, like a blueberry, for example, you're going to eat the whole berry, right? You're not going to peel the outer layer. You definitely want to go organic. It's easy for pests to eat to to bite into a blueberry as well. So they use more pesticides, more herbicides on that. Whereas something like garlic, for example, or a banana or avocado, you're going to peel that outer layer right and eat the inner layer.
It's harder for pests. They have a hard skin that makes it harder for pests to get in and penetrate. So there's going to be lower amounts of chemicals on the conventionally grown avocados or banana or garlic. And so those would be the ones that would be okay to get non-organic. Maybe talk a little bit about that. And what you do with these people and why it's also important for autoimmunity. Yeah. Sleep is so critical right.
So basically our master hormone melatonin. So when we're sleeping at night right. Let's say as, as the sun goes down at night and it gets dark and let's our ancestors would have gone to bed shortly after that if they were exposed to any light. It was fire. And that which is more of like an orange reddish light. And that kind of light doesn't block melatonin levels, whereas the light we're exposed to in our homes or, you know, if you're working, it's this blue light, very bright blue light. And that blue light inhibits melatonin production.
Normally at night, as the sun goes down, melatonin rises. Melatonin is our number one endogenous mitochondrial antioxidant, right. So we know it as a sleep hormone. But it's an incredible antioxidant within the mitochondria can slip in and out of the double membrane of the mitochondria and really help clean it up and help, help basically pull us out of a cell danger response and help protect the mitochondria from oxidative stress. So melatonin is key. And then also we get this rise of human growth hormone.
And growth hormone is this superhero hormone that tells us to burn fat, preserve lean body tissue, helps balance the immune system, helps improve our skin hair, nails. Right. They call it the anti-aging hormone because it has all these anti-aging, natural healing mechanisms. However, when we're exposed to blue light at night, so let's say we're on devices or we're just in front of lights, that is going to lower our melatonin production and growth hormone production. And so then later, you know, we finally fall asleep and we go to sleep, but we're not producing the melatonin and the growth hormone that we need to really heal.
Sleep, circadian rhythm, and infrared therapy 45:30
And regenerate. Well. And then oftentimes, you know, most people are not going outside much during the day. So we actually set our natural circadian rhythm when we go outside, particularly getting outside, getting some sun exposure early in the day. We know infrared, which is actually part of the sun that we don't see. It's non-visible light. But infrared actually stimulates mitochondrial melatonin production, right, to help clean up the mitochondria. So we're out in nature. When we're out in the sun, we are getting this infrared exposure all throughout the day.
And that's setting that circadian rhythm. In fact, early in the day when you get out and get sun exposure, that tells the, that tells the circadian rhythm, yeah. You have your brain's circadian rhythm, and you have your peripheral circadian rhythm within all the cells in the body that it's daytime. And let's produce energy. Let's produce lots of cellular energy. We know that, you know, within 12 hours or so, we're going to start to get ready for sleep. So it actually tells a body when it helps set a timer so your body can wind down later in the day.
And you can get the right hormone secretion for optimal recovery. If you're just sleeping random times and you're exposed to blue light and then you go to bed, you are you are sacrificing the amount of melatonin and growth hormone that you're going to get. And so your body is aging faster than it should if you have proper melatonin, a growth hormone. And of course you're going to feel it. You know, you're going to have less mental energy, less energy in general. Your immune system's not going to function well because you're not healing and regenerating the way you should be each night while you sleep.
